Subject: Graphlume cut-over complete

The dependency graph visualizer moved to the new render tier at 02:10 tonight. Old edge-cache nodes are drained but not decommissioned, so a rollback is still possible until Thursday. Watch the layout queue depth during the morning peak; anything above baseline for ten minutes warrants paging me. The values now live on the service are as follows.

service settings:
PRAIX_LOG_LEVEL=error
PRAIX_METRICS_HOST=metrics.praix.qorvelcorp.corp
PRAIX_POOL_SIZE=16

Handover note — from Director Malin Ostrova to Director Pell Warrick. As of this quarter, hiring in the Carveth Division is frozen pending budget review. Sales leads should route staffing requests through existing headcount only; no external offers until further notice. Open requisitions are paused, not cancelled. Pell will field exceptions. The context for this decision is summarised below.

board note of fahif-yahog: Gross margin on Wenath came in at 10 percent against a plan of 5 percent. Only 3 of the 100 pilot accounts renewed Wenath, so a churn review is set for July 15.

Subject: DR Drill — Checkout Load Test Recovery Path

Team, during Thursday's disaster-recovery drill for the Orchardgate checkout flow, we will deliberately sever the load-test controller from the Bramblewick results store. As the reviewer of the failover patch, please confirm the reconnect logic retries with backoff and does not replay completed checkout transactions. Once the controller is restored, the drill operator will re-authenticate to the recovery endpoint using the passphrase provided on the line below.

unlock words, yadup-yagef: zorael-druix

# Break-Glass: Catalog Cache Invalidation

Scope: the Pinrow product catalog at Veldstone Retail. If stale prices persist after a purge and the Hollowmere invalidation queue is wedged, use break-glass to flush the edge tier directly. Contractors: get verbal sign-off from the catalog lead first. Steps: open the Hollowmere admin shell, select emergency-flush, confirm the tenant, and run it once — repeated flushes thrash the origin. Access is logged and expires after 20 minutes. Unseal the admin shell with the passphrase below.

recovery phrase for kahop-tajog: istix-casvan